Children’s Hospital of Michigan is the leader in pediatric care in Michigan and is looking for a well-trained physician to join our 13-member team with a long running history within the community; the Pediatric Critical Care Medicine Program was the first accredited in the Midwest! The position allows for on-service and on-call shared among the group. There are always two attending physicians on-service in the PICU during weekdays; one covers medical/surgical subspecialty patients while the other covers cardiovascular surgery patients. One attending physician at a time is on in-house night and weekend call along with fellow and resident in-house coverage. The average daily patient census is about 30 patients, but this varies throughout the year.

All applicants must be Pediatric Critical Care Medicine specialists who are BE/BC and have a favorable malpractice history. The ideal candidate will be looking for a busy academic clinical practice with opportunities in medical education and research. Additional training and/or experience in cardiac/cardiovascular critical care would be a plus.

This is a great group to join as it is a strong group of critical care physicians who pursue clinical excellence in their work. Also, there is a strong relationship with the Division of Cardiovascular Surgery, and there is Pediatric Intensivist coverage of all CV patients. Within The Children's Hospital of Michigan and University Pediatricians, there is an availability of all pediatric medical and surgical subspecialties. Also, our new tower at Children's Hospital of Michigan (which will include a 48-bed PICU) is projected to open in 2017. There are also a large pediatric and emergency medicine residency programs whose residents rotate through the PICU and a well-established pediatric critical care medicine fellowship program.
